Decoding the Reset Process: Step-by-Step

ABB's MX-Series breakers require specific reset protocols after tripping events. Here's what you need to know:

Standard Reset Procedure (Normal Conditions)

  1. Confirm full discharge of stored energy (LED indicator shows green)
  2. Push reset button firmly for 3 seconds
  3. Listen for audible click confirming mechanism engagement

Advanced Troubleshooting (Multiple Trip Scenarios)

When dealing with repeated tripping, consider these factors before resetting:

IssueDiagnostic Check
OvercurrentLoad bank testing
Arc faultsInfrared inspection
Component wearContact resistance measurement

Maintenance Best Practices

To maximize your reset button's lifespan:

  • Conduct monthly tactile feedback tests
  • Clean contacts biannually with non-conductive solvents
  • Replace springs every 5,000 operations

You know, many facilities overlook the mechanical aspects—they'll focus on electrical specs while the actual reset mechanism degrades from simple wear and tear.
